Electrical Associate I (Finance)



DESCRIPTION

Michael Baker International is seeking to hire a full time Electrical Associate I to work out of our San Diego, CA office. As a part of our Electrical Engineering Design Team, you will develop electrical design drawings (one-lines, grounding plans, power distribution, panel schedules, lighting layouts, control diagrams, fixture schedules, riser diagrams, rack layouts, connections details, etc.). You will prepare construction specifications and calculations to support the design. You will build and maintain critical relationships with peers, customers, subcontractors, and vendors. You will provide technical direction to Computer Aided Design (CAD) technicians. You will perform a supporting role in the development of technical proposals and will provide preliminary design information for design-build proposals. Support Federal. RESPONSIBILITIES

  • The majority of your day would be spent working as a design team member developing designs for industrial facilities.
  • You will prepare formal calculations, as needed, and provide input to construction drawing packages.
  • You will perform the research required to provide solutions to unique challenges in electrical engineering related to, primarily, industrial facility design.
  • You will write technical documents to support engineering studies and infrastructure planning activities.
  • Clearly convey information to internal and external clients.
  • Feel a sense of pride in knowing that you are helping to design safe, high-quality facilities that will meet critical national interests.
  • Travel occasionally, as required.

PROFESSIONAL REQUIREMENTS
  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ering from an accredited four-year college or university required.
  • A U.S. Citizen with no dual-citizenship.
  • EIT license for Electrical Engineering preferred.
  • Experience with AutoCAD, Revit, SKM, Visual Pro, AGI Or BIM preferred.
  • Experience with fire alarm design and/or instrumentation and controls design preferred.

COMPENSATION
The approximate compensation range for this position is $66,000- $95,000 per year. This compensation range is a good faith estimate for the position at the time of posting. Actual compensation is dependent upon factors such as education, qualifications, experience, skillset, and physical work location.
